The Upwelling Festival, Portland (Nov 2)
An upwelling is when cold water ‘wells up’ from the ocean floor due to winds blowing along the shore. This nutrient-rich water replaces the water on top of the ocean, and therefore provides optimum fishing grounds.
For 10 years the Portland community has celebrated this natural phenomenon and the benefits that go with being one of Victoria’s iconic fishing destinations – with its beautifully scenic rock formations and very deep waters over 10,000 metres.
The Upwelling Festival is a free event featuring the Blessing of the Fleet, a street parade, markets, local entertainment, marine environment talks and community art projects.

Dragon Boat Regatta, Warrnambool (Nov 2- 3)
This is an exciting event to watch on Warrnambool’s stunning Hopkins River, right in the middle of town.
For the newbies, dragon boat racing dates back to China at least 2000 years ago. The canoe type boat is traditionally rigged with decorative Chinese dragon heads and tails. There can be around eight people in a standard boat and up to 20 in a big one!
There will be come-and-try sessions on Saturday and racing on Sunday, so, bring a picnic and a rug and kick back on the river bank to cheer the rowers!
